Loughton
St Mary’s, Loughton, dating to the 13th century, is a modest medieval church with original stonework and a peaceful tree-lined churchyard. Smaller than nearby St John’s, it offers a timeless, intimate place of worship and reflection.

Epping
Epping Golf Course is an 18-hole parkland course (par 70, 6,200 yards) with tree-lined fairways, quality greens, and a layout that challenges all abilities. Facilities include a practice range, putting green, 3-hole par-3 course, pro shop, buggy…
